国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 編程 > C++ > 正文

[華為OJ--C++]038-iNOC產品部-楊輝三角的變形

2019-11-08 03:15:32
字體:
來源:轉載
供稿:網友

題目描述:

                    1

               1    1    1

          1    2    3    2   1

     1    3    6    7    6    3   1

1   4    10   16   19   16   10   4   1

以上三角形的數陣,第一行只有一個數1,以下每行的每個數是它上面左上角到右上角3個數之和(如果不存在某個數,認為該數就是0)。求第n行第一個偶數出現的位置。如果沒有偶數,則輸出-1。例如輸入3,則輸出2,輸入4則輸出3。輸入n(n <= 1000000000)

 輸入描述:輸入一個int整數 

輸出描述:輸出返回的int值

輸入例子:4

輸出例子:3

算法實現:

#include<iostream>using namespace std;/************************************************   * Author: 趙志乾   * Date: 2017-2-17    * Declaration: All Rigths Reserved !!!   ***********************************************/int main(){	long line;	cin>>line;	if(line==1||line==2)		cout<<-1<<endl;	else if(line%2==1)		cout<<2<<endl;	else if(line%4==0)		cout<<3<<endl;	else if(line%4==2)		cout<<4<<endl;	return 0;}

關鍵點:其結果只可能是 -1,2,3,4幾種情況;


發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表

圖片精選

主站蜘蛛池模板: 长宁区| 镇赉县| 长乐市| 广宗县| 哈密市| 得荣县| 福安市| 台中市| 道孚县| 玛多县| 绥芬河市| 临安市| 通城县| 墨脱县| 滨州市| 镇赉县| 乃东县| 梅州市| 黄陵县| 安阳县| 金阳县| 青浦区| 河间市| 邹平县| 沈丘县| 屯门区| 新余市| 蓬溪县| 镇巴县| 德保县| 岳池县| 宜川县| 南部县| 新建县| 英山县| 通化县| 宁乡县| 平凉市| 法库县| 武鸣县| 曲松县|